Cracked Pivot Pin

Bi fold doors, as any other door, will wear out with time. The wear and tear can be due to the door's installation that is not up to par or weather conditions. However, most of these problems are easily resolved with simple maintenance.

The most frequent issue with bi fold doors is when it begins to slide or scrape against the floor. This can be caused by adding carpet to the floor or changing flooring materials. It could be caused by defective hardware, or pins that are broken. Luckily, there are three basic adjustments that can be made to correct this problem.

Start by loosening a bit the top set screw of the pivot bolt using the help of a wrench. Then employ a screwdriver to tighten it again. This will allow you to re-align your door. This procedure may be repeated several times to ensure that the door is aligned correctly.

When the anchor/pivot pins are re-aligned, check to ensure that they aren't cracked. If they're cracked you can glue and secure them together. However it's likely to be a temporary solution. If the crack is large, you'll need to replace the pivot.

You can also pull the pin that has broken off and then go to an industrial machine shop to create a new cap from Delrin or Nylon. Then, you'll be able to attach it to the metal pin that's already there. You'll need to save the cracked cover to hand over to the machine shop to allow them to duplicate the outside dimensions of the cap.

The final step is to ensure that the pivot bolt is lubricated with grease. This will help it move more smoothly, however, you must ensure that the grease doesn't contain Molybdenum Di Sulfide, as it can cause corrosion in high stress zones.

Broken Rollers

If a bi fold door has broken rollers it can be an annoying issue to address. If it's the bottom rollers or the top hanging, this could cause issues and they usually need to be replaced. The issue can be complicated as it may be difficult to reach the rollers based on how your doors are installed and the kind of track is being used.

A squeaking sound from the bifold doors is a common problem that occurs with them. This could indicate that you must clean the tracks or lubricate them. This could also be a sign that something is stuck in the track and it needs to removed. It is also possible to grease your hinges since they could dry out.

When your bifold doors start making a squeaking sound the first step you can take is to stop using them and determine what's causing the issue. It is not advisable to force the door open since this could cause further damage and increase your repair costs. The next step is to seek bifold door seal replacement out an expert to examine the problem.

There may be a squeak if you have dirt, sand or gravel on the tracks. This can cause the roller to break off. It is recommended that you check the tracks at least once per month to ensure that they are free of debris and sand. You can make use of compressed air to remove any hard-to-remove debris.
